The Importance of Battery Size and Capacity
Now, let’s dive deeper into one of the most crucial components: the battery. It’s the heart of any electric vehicle, responsible for powering your ride. The battery is essentially a device that stores energy and releases it when you need to drive. But how does this impact the overall cost?
You see, the larger the battery size, the more power it can store, translating into longer ranges between charges. Consequently, a larger battery will usually come at a higher price tag.
Navigating Battery Prices: Trends and Predictions
But here’s the catch – battery prices have been on a rollercoaster ride in recent years. These are influenced by various factors such as technological advancements, government subsidies, and global supply chains.
The trend has been clear: batteries are becoming more affordable and powerful. This is primarily due to continuous research and development in the field of battery technology.
Looking Ahead to 2025
Predicting future prices for EVs is a complex task, but it’s fascinating nonetheless. Based on current trends, we can expect that the cost of cart and battery will continue to decline in 2025.
Here are some factors that might influence this trend:
- Increased competition from established car manufacturers: We’ll see more brands entering the EV market, leading to price wars and more affordable options for consumers.
- Technological advancements: Research is continuously progressing, offering breakthroughs in battery technology that will drive down costs and increase efficiency.
- Government regulations and incentives: Government policies designed to accelerate EV adoption are likely to incentivize manufacturers to keep prices competitive.

The Role of Government Policy and Incentives
Government regulations play a significant role in shaping the EV market. Subsidies, tax breaks, and other incentives can encourage the production and adoption of EVs, which ultimately lowers costs for consumers.
As governments around the world embrace sustainability and strive to reduce their carbon footprints, there’s a growing momentum towards incentivizing electric mobility.
